About this activity

Join local fishermen on a 3-hour boat excursion in Mirissa's coastal waters, where you'll learn traditional fishing techniques while exploring the Indian Ocean. This hands-on experience offers authentic insight into Sri Lanka's fishing culture with flexibility to stay out as long as you'd like.

Our travelers experience a unique blend in our activities. In this particular activity with fishing we give our travelers the experience to explore the area with freedom and will only come back to shore once the travelers are satisfied with the fetch.

Insider tips

  • Go early morning (5–7 AM) for the best fishing conditions and calmest seas
  • Bring seasickness medication if you're prone to motion sickness; the ocean can be choppy
  • Wear quick-dry clothing and reef-safe sunscreen; the sun reflects intensely off the water
  • Ask fishermen about their catch and local fish species — they're usually happy to share knowledge

Good to know

  • Base duration is 3 hours, but you can extend if fishing is good and conditions permit
  • Bring a hat, sunglasses, and a light jacket for wind and sun protection
  • Closed-toe water shoes recommended for safety on the boat
  • Typically departs from Mirissa Beach; confirm exact meeting point when booking
  • Not recommended for guests with severe mobility issues; boat access involves steps and uneven surfaces

Best time to visit

Early morning departures (before 7 AM) offer the best fishing activity and calmer seas. Visit during December to March for the most reliable weather and optimal ocean conditions.
